**Action item (from the Quicknest autocomplete outage):** The address widget was hammering the suggest endpoint on every keystroke, which tipped over the Larkfield cluster during Tuesday's promo. Priya's fix adds debounce plus a minimum-prefix gate. Owner: Tomas, due next sprint. The new values we settled on after load testing are below.

constants for kaduf-yafof:
QUOTAS = {
    "pelok": 447,
    "belwyn": 538,
    "fendor": 974,
    "olidor": 242,
    "holeth": 907,
    "olieth": 729,
    "casath": 432,
}

- [ ] **Step 7: Breaker override escrow.** After sealing the signing keys for the Tallgrove upstream API circuit breaker, confirm the support team can force the breaker open during a full outage. The override bundle lives in the sealed escrow drawer and is useless without its unlock phrase. Two ceremony witnesses must initial this step before proceeding. The escrow bundle is decrypted with the recovery passphrase that follows.

vault phrase of kahip-kahop = holath-quenmir

# Break-Glass: Catalog Cache Invalidation

Scope: the Pinrow product catalog at Veldstone Retail. If stale prices persist after a purge and the Hollowmere invalidation queue is wedged, use break-glass to flush the edge tier directly. Contractors: get verbal sign-off from the catalog lead first. Steps: open the Hollowmere admin shell, select emergency-flush, confirm the tenant, and run it once — repeated flushes thrash the origin. Access is logged and expires after 20 minutes. Unseal the admin shell with the passphrase below.

recovery phrase for kahop-tajog: istix-casvan

Subject: Prototype Workshop Access — Week One

Hello and welcome to Quillbern Dynamics. Your induction includes a tour of the prototype workshop in Building 2. Safety glasses are provided at the door; closed shoes are mandatory. The workshop entrance uses a keypad rather than badge readers during your first week, so please use the entry code below.

turnstile pass: bdg-YPPQB-52010